Clinical profile and outcomes of modified internal limiting membrane peeling technique in patients with large macular hole
Aim: The aim of this study was to assess the clinical profile and outcomes of the modified internal limiting membrane (ILM) peeling technique in patients with large macular holes (MHs) (400 μm).
